๐Ÿ“š Introduction to Accessibility Technology

Accessibility technology, often called assistive technology (AT), encompasses a wide array of tools and devices designed to help individuals with disabilities learn, work, and participate more fully in daily activities. For students, AT can be transformative, leveling the playing field and fostering independence.

๐Ÿ“œ History and Background

The history of accessibility technology is intertwined with the disability rights movement. Early innovations focused on basic needs like mobility and communication. The rise of computers and the internet opened new possibilities, leading to sophisticated software and hardware solutions tailored to diverse learning needs. Legislation like the Americans with Disabilities Act (ADA) has further propelled the development and adoption of AT in educational settings.

๐Ÿ’ป Common Types of Accessibility Technology

  • Screen Readers: Software that converts text into synthesized speech, enabling visually impaired students to access digital content.
    • ๐Ÿ‘‚ Example: JAWS (Job Access With Speech)
  • Screen Magnifiers: Software that enlarges portions of the screen, making it easier for students with low vision to see text and images.
    • ๐Ÿ‘๏ธ Example: ZoomText
  • Alternative Keyboards and Mice: Adapted input devices for students with motor impairments, allowing them to type and navigate computers more easily.
    • โŒจ๏ธ Example: Keyguards, trackball mice
  • Speech-to-Text Software: Allows students to dictate text into a computer, useful for students with writing difficulties or physical limitations.
    • ๐Ÿ—ฃ๏ธ Example: Dragon NaturallySpeaking
  • Text-to-Speech Software: Reads digital text aloud, aiding comprehension and reading fluency.
    • ๐ŸŽง Example: NaturalReader
  • Assistive Listening Devices (ALDs): Amplifies sound for students with hearing impairments, improving their ability to hear lectures and participate in discussions.
    • ๐Ÿฆป Example: FM systems, hearing aids
  • Organizational Software: Tools that help students with executive function challenges manage their time, tasks, and materials.
    • ๐Ÿ“… Example: Google Calendar, Trello
  • Alternative and Augmentative Communication (AAC) Devices: Devices that help students with communication difficulties express themselves.
    • ๐Ÿ’ฌ Example: Communication boards, speech-generating devices

๐Ÿ“ Real-World Examples

  • ๐Ÿ“– A student with dyslexia uses text-to-speech software to listen to their textbooks, improving reading comprehension.
  • โœ๏ธ A student with cerebral palsy uses speech-to-text software to write essays and complete assignments.
  • ๐Ÿง‘โ€๐Ÿซ A student with ADHD uses organizational software to stay on track with their schoolwork.
  • ๐Ÿง‘โ€๐Ÿฆฏ A student with visual impairment uses a screen reader to access online learning materials.
